精华内容
下载资源
问答
  • centos 删除Redis

    千次阅读 2019-06-20 11:08:08
    #删除redis 1、查看redis进程; ps aux|grep redis 2、kill掉进程; kill 进程id 3、进入到redis目录 cd /usr/local/ 4、删除redis对应的文件 rm -f /usr/local/redis/bin/redis* 5、删除对应的文件 rm -rf ...

    #删除redis

    1、查看redis进程;

    ps aux|grep redis
    

    2、kill掉进程;

    kill 进程id
    

    3、进入到redis目录

    cd /usr/local/
    

    4、删除redis对应的文件

    rm -f /usr/local/redis/bin/redis*
    

    5、删除对应的文件

    rm -rf redis
    

    卸载完成;

    展开全文
  • del 删除单个key方便 要是删除多个就不是很方便了 这时候可以使用xsrsg来批量删除 1.退出redis 2.匹配product开头的所有key*删除 redis-cli -a 你的密码 ...3.redis返回删除条数 (integer) 4如果为0就是删除失败

    del 删除单个key方便 要是删除多个就不是很方便了 这时候可以使用xsrsg来批量删除

    1.退出redis

    2.匹配product开头的所有key*删除

    redis-cli -a 你的密码 keys 'product*' | xargs redis-cli -a 你的密码 del

    ps:密码没有请忽略

    3.redis返回删除条数

    (integer) 4
    如果为0就是删除失败

    展开全文
  • 批量删除redis keys

    千次阅读 2017-07-28 11:32:41
    批量删除redis keysredis-cli keys “keyname*” | xargs redis-cli del 如果redis服务设置了密码,使用下面命令删除redis-cli -a password keys “keyname*” | xargs -a password redis-cli del

    批量删除redis keys

    redis-cli keys “keyname*” | xargs redis-cli del

    如果redis服务设置了密码,使用下面命令删除:

    redis-cli -a password keys “keyname*” | xargs -a password redis-cli del

    展开全文
  • redis】批量删除redis集合中数据

    千次阅读 2019-07-23 17:25:08
    今天在解决问题时,要批量删除redis中的一个集合中的数据。 想到要先备份数据再删除。操作方式如下: 备份数据: echo "smembers smkey" | redis-cli -h you-host -a you-key -p 6379 -n 0 >> ./list.log ...

    今天在解决问题时,要批量删除redis中的一个集合中的数据。

    想到要先备份数据再删除。操作方式如下:

    备份数据:

    echo "smembers smkey" | redis-cli -h you-host -a you-key -p 6379 -n 0  >> ./list.log

    smkey中的数据就会自动写入到list.log文件中

    删除数据:

    redis提供了删除的方法srem Allianceblacklist  但每次只能删除一条,为了方便操作,我将删除语句写到一个文件del_list.log当中。

    然后通过命令行执行这条语句

    cat ./del_list.log | redis-cli -h you-host -a you-key -p 6379 -n 0

     

    如果发现误删除了,还可以通过备份文件恢复,创建添加文件add_list.log

    执行语句

    cat ./add_list.log | redis-cli -h you-host -a you-key -p 6379 -n 0

    展开全文
  • 批量删除redis 数据库中redis key的方法如下: bin/redis-cli –h -p 6379 -n -a keys "mykeys*" | xargs bin/redis-cli -n  del
  • 删除Redis服务重新安装 一、删除Redis服务 以管理员身份运行cmd 执行命令:sc delete [服务名] sc delete Redis 第一次执行是一直没有打印提醒,于是有了一下第二次执行命令,显示Redis服务已被删除 如果提示...
  • 批量删除 redis key

    千次阅读 2013-12-16 12:01:06
    redis-cli -a pass -n 0 keys "messageKey-2*" | xargs redis-cli -a pass -n 0 del ...批量删除redis key as 表示 需要输入密码pass 如果没有-a 会导致报错(error) ERR operation not permitted
  • 如何删除Redis中的所有key 如何删除Redis中的所有内容 我要删除所有key。,然后给我一个空白的数据库。 有没有办法在Redis客户端中做到这一点? 使用redis-cli: FLUSHDB–从连接的当前数据库中删除所有密钥...
  • 批量删除redis缓存(模糊匹配key)

    万次阅读 2018-09-17 09:05:51
    就是删除redis中名叫redis-cli KEYS "user:*"的key, 而反向引号是先执行反向引号中的内容取结果,就是说, redis-cli DEL redis-cli KEYS "user:*" 先执行的是redis-cli KEYS "u...
  • docker删除redis数据

    2020-04-24 11:15:59
    1、docker ps -a 查看当前运行的容器 2、进入redis客户端 docker exec -it xxx(ID) redis-cli 3、查询所有key: keys * 4、删除指定key:del xxx(key) 5、退出容器 exit ...
  • 模糊删除redis

    千次阅读 2018-03-13 16:28:40
    redis-cli keys "mpm_operate_QZ*" | xargs redis-cli del
  • 因为近期实现功能中经常用到redis来做数据缓存处理。...以下是写入、读取、删除、异步删除redis内容的简单操作方法。 /// <summary> /// 向Redis写入 /// </summary> /// <param name="key"&
  • laravel中批量删除redis 某前缀的操作 这是用了redis门面的写法 原生的话,类似 $keys = Redis::keys('laravel:ProductList:'.'*'); if (!empty($keys)) { Redis::del($keys); }
  • 一行代码删除redis里面指定数据

    千次阅读 2018-11-15 16:30:11
    目录一行代码删除指定redis数据一行代码删除所有redis数据 一行代码删除指定redis数据 redis-cli -a 密码 keys &quot;XY_KEY_100001111_*&quot; | xargs redis-cli -a 密码 del 如上是删除以“XY_KEY_...
  • 如何批量删除redis中的key

    千次阅读 2015-05-04 16:22:13
    如何批量删除redis中的key看似比较简单,但有些值得注意的地方: 在linux环境: shell>redis-cli -a password keys "tmatch*"|xargs redis-cli -a password del 在windows环境: shell>redis-cli.exe -a ...
  • 使用spring boot2.x cache —— redis作为数据缓存方案时,可以采用@CacheEvict用来清除相应的数据缓存,但是@CacheEvict底层使用的redis的keys命令来遍历查找,但是keys太过暴力,不支持offset、limit参数,而且是...
  • 批量删除redis的key

    千次阅读 2018-08-13 11:22:30
    Redis 中有删除单个 Key 的指令 DEL,但好像没有批量删除 Key 的指令,不过我们可以借助 Linux 的 xargs 指令来完成这个动作 先看看在删除前的数据: 现在需要批量删除这些key,这些key有些是哈希存储的。 退出...
  •  最近做业务,有涉及到批量删除redis中的缓存数据,经过网上查找,自己测试,得出了根据key前缀,批量删除redis缓存的方法,话不多说,直接上代码。 代码: /** * 根据key前缀批量删除缓存 * @param key *...
  • 批量删除Redis数据库中键

    千次阅读 2018-05-23 13:42:59
    批量删除KeyRedis 中有删除单个 Key 的指令 DEL,但好像没有批量删除 Key 的指令,不过我们可以借助 Linux 的 xargs 指令来完成这个动作 redis-cli keys "*" | xargs redis-cli del //如果redis-...
  • 删除redis所有KEY

    万次阅读 2015-07-09 10:27:26
    Redis 中有删除单个 Key 的指令 DEL,但好像没有批量删除 Key 的指令,不过我们可以借助 Linux 的 xargs 指令来完成这个动作 1 2 3 redis-cli keys "*" | xargs redis-cli del //如果redis-cli没有...
  • Linux命令批量删除Redis的key   参考 : http://www.lxway.com/54805092.htm      redis-cli KEYS "yourkeys_*" | xargs redis-cli DEL            
  • 1、例如 :删除本机127.0.0.1,默认端口6379,密码为123456的redis服务上org开头的key ./redis-cli -h 127.0.0.1 -p 6379 -a 123456 keys 'org*' | xargs ./redis-cli -h 127.0.0.1 -p 6379 -a 123456 del  2、...
  • 先准备好一些不活跃用户的userId数据,作为一个文件,读入这个文件 #!/bin/bash ... redis-cli -h redis服务ip -a redis服务密码 keys messages:box:$user-0 |xargs redis-cli -h redis服务ip -a r...
  • 批量删除redis 有相同前缀的命令

    千次阅读 2019-09-19 14:35:50
    使用redis 自带的命令,只能一次删除一个key 比如:del key 如果一次需要批量删除多个有相同前缀或后缀的,则需要借助于linux 的 xargs 命令 在任意目录下执行,不需要使用redis-cli 先登录 redis-cli -a abc ...
  • 删除redis所有KEY(正则删除

    千次阅读 2019-08-13 15:23:29
    转... redis-cli -h localhost -p 6379 keys "alert_time_list*"| xargs redis-cli -h localhost -p 6379 -n 0 del 批量删除Key Redis 中有删除单个 Key 的指令 DEL,但好...
  • | xargs redis-cli del//如果redis-cli没有设置成系统变量,需要指定redis-cli的完整路径//如:/opt/redis/redis-cli keys "*" | xargs /opt/redis/redis-cli del如果要指定 Redis 数据库访问密码,使用...
  • python删除redis数据库中的键

    千次阅读 2019-06-11 16:45:07
    from redis import Redis redis_db = Redis(host=REDIS_HOST, port=REDIS_PORT, db=REDIS_DB) redis_db.delete(key, )
  • 开发时,本机(win10系统)安装了一个Redis服务器,现在需要清除指定库db2下的key ...步骤 启动redis客户端 选择对应的库,并查看数据...eval "redis.call('del', unpack(redis.call('keys','*')))" 0 // 删除db2中全部
  • Linux 批量删除 Redis 中的 key

    千次阅读 2018-10-27 13:13:03
    redis-cli keys &quot;TOKEN*&quot; | xargs redis-cli DEL * 是通配符,表示匹配所有字符, TOKEN* 的意思是匹配所有以 TOKEN 开头的 key,如:TOKEN123、TOKENA、TOKEN_INFO Redis 有密码: redis-cli -a...
  • python模式匹配批量删除redis中的key

    千次阅读 2019-05-13 15:30:08
    1、redis单例模式 前提:安装 pip install redis import redis r = redis.Redis(host='192.168.30.153', port=6383,db=0,decode_responses=True) list_keys = r.keys("http*") for key in list_keys: r....

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 213,347
精华内容 85,338
关键字:

如何删除redis

redis 订阅